front_idill/extern/fajran-npTuioClient/TuioClient/TuioClient.cpp
changeset 25 a7b0e40bcab0
parent 24 2bdf5d51d434
child 27 6c08d4d7219e
--- a/front_idill/extern/fajran-npTuioClient/TuioClient/TuioClient.cpp	Fri Apr 06 11:48:00 2012 +0200
+++ b/front_idill/extern/fajran-npTuioClient/TuioClient/TuioClient.cpp	Fri Apr 06 18:32:13 2012 +0200
@@ -189,7 +189,7 @@
 						delete *closestCursor;
 					} else maxFingerID = f_id;	
 					//Modifié par alexandre.bastien@iri.centrepompidou.fr
-					TuioCursor *addCursor = new TuioCursor((long)s_id,f_id,xpos,ypos);
+					TuioCursor *addCursor = new TuioCursor((long)s_id,f_id,xpos,ypos,zpos);
 					cursorList.push_back(addCursor);
 					
 					for (std::list<TuioListener*>::iterator listener=listenerList.begin(); listener != listenerList.end(); listener++)
@@ -197,7 +197,7 @@
 					
 				//Modifié par alexandre.bastien@iri.centrepompidou.fr
 				} else if ( ((*tcur)->getX()!=xpos) || ((*tcur)->getY()!=ypos) || ((*tcur)->getZ()!=zpos) || ((*tcur)->getXSpeed()!=xspeed) || ((*tcur)->getYSpeed()!=yspeed) || ((*tcur)->getMotionAccel()!=maccel) ) {
-					(*tcur)->update(xpos,ypos,xspeed,yspeed,maccel);
+					(*tcur)->update(xpos,ypos,zpos,xspeed,yspeed,maccel);
 					for (std::list<TuioListener*>::iterator listener=listenerList.begin(); listener != listenerList.end(); listener++)
 						(*listener)->updateTuioCursor((*tcur));
 				}